prog_run_opts already verifies that BPF_PROG_TEST_RUN returns -ENOSPC
for a short data_out buffer while still reporting the full output size
through data_size_out.

Add the same coverage for non-linear test_run output. Use pass-through
TC and XDP programs with a 9000-byte packet, a 64-byte linear data area,
and a 100-byte data_out buffer. The expected output spans both the linear
data and the first fragment.

Verify that test_run returns -ENOSPC, reports the full packet length
through data_size_out, and copies the packet prefix into data_out for
both non-linear skb and XDP frags paths.

+static void init_pkt(__u8 *pkt, size_t len)
+{
+       size_t i;
+
+       for (i = 0; i < len; i++)
+               pkt[i] = i & 0xff;
+}
+
+static void test_skb_nonlinear_data_out_partial(struct test_pkt_access *skel)
+{
+       LIBBPF_OPTS(bpf_test_run_opts, topts);
+       __u8 pkt[NONLINEAR_PKT_LEN];
+       __u8 out[SHORT_OUT_LEN];
+       struct __sk_buff skb = {};
+       int prog_fd, err;
+
+       init_pkt(pkt, sizeof(pkt));
+       memset(out, 0xa5, sizeof(out));
+
+       skb.data_end = NONLINEAR_LINEAR_DATA_LEN;
+
+       topts.data_in = pkt;
+       topts.data_size_in = sizeof(pkt);
+       topts.data_out = out;
+       topts.data_size_out = sizeof(out);
+       topts.ctx_in = &skb;
+       topts.ctx_size_in = sizeof(skb);
+
+       prog_fd = bpf_program__fd(skel->progs.tc_pass_prog);
+       err = bpf_prog_test_run_opts(prog_fd, &topts);
+
+       ASSERT_EQ(err, -ENOSPC, "skb_nonlinear_partial_err");
+       ASSERT_EQ(topts.data_size_out, sizeof(pkt), 
"skb_nonlinear_partial_data_size_out");
+       ASSERT_OK(memcmp(out, pkt, sizeof(out)), 
"skb_nonlinear_partial_data_out");
+}
+
+static void test_xdp_nonlinear_data_out_partial(struct test_pkt_access *skel)
+{
+       LIBBPF_OPTS(bpf_test_run_opts, topts);
+       __u8 pkt[NONLINEAR_PKT_LEN];
+       __u8 out[SHORT_OUT_LEN];
+       struct xdp_md ctx = {};
+       int prog_fd, err;
+
+       init_pkt(pkt, sizeof(pkt));
+       memset(out, 0xa5, sizeof(out));
+
+       ctx.data = 0;
+       ctx.data_end = NONLINEAR_LINEAR_DATA_LEN;
+
+       topts.data_in = pkt;
+       topts.data_size_in = sizeof(pkt);
+       topts.data_out = out;
+       topts.data_size_out = sizeof(out);
+       topts.ctx_in = &ctx;
+       topts.ctx_size_in = sizeof(ctx);
+
+       prog_fd = bpf_program__fd(skel->progs.xdp_frags_pass_prog);
+       err = bpf_prog_test_run_opts(prog_fd, &topts);
+
+       ASSERT_EQ(err, -ENOSPC, "xdp_nonlinear_partial_err");
+       ASSERT_EQ(topts.data_size_out, sizeof(pkt), 
"xdp_nonlinear_partial_data_size_out");
+       ASSERT_OK(memcmp(out, pkt, sizeof(out)), 
"xdp_nonlinear_partial_data_out");
+}
